What is a freshwater pearl necklace?

A freshwater pearl necklace uses cultured pearls grown inside freshwater mussels rather than saltwater oysters. A technician inserts a small piece of mantle tissue into the mussel, and the animal deposits nacre around it for two to six years. The result is a real cultured pearl, not an imitation.

Most freshwater pearls are grown without a bead nucleus, which means they are solid nacre through to the center. Akoya and South Sea pearls are bead-nucleated, with a nacre layer over a shell bead. That difference explains almost everything else about how freshwater pearls look and behave.

Are freshwater pearls real pearls?

Yes. Freshwater pearls are real cultured pearls. The difference from a saltwater pearl is the mollusk and the water, not the authenticity. Under the FTC Jewelry Guides they may be described as cultured pearls without qualification, and we label every one that way.

A well-grown freshwater pearl with strong luster outperforms a poorly grown Akoya. Judge the pearl in front of you rather than the category it belongs to.

Why do freshwater pearls come in so many shapes?

Because there is nothing round at the core. With no bead nucleus to build around, the mussel produces ovals, drops, buttons, seed shapes and baroques as readily as spheres. That is the practical reason freshwater necklaces offer more variety than any other pearl type.

  • Round — holds an unbroken line at the collarbone. The classic reading.
  • Baroque — irregular, so no two necklaces hang alike. Reads as a design decision.
  • Seed — tiny pearls strung densely, giving texture up close and a soft line from across a room.
  • Drop — tapered at the top and weighted at the base, following the line of a neckline.

Which freshwater pearl necklace style suits you?

Pendant and single pearl styles

One pearl on a chain, sitting where the eye already goes. This is the piece most women buy first and keep wearing after everything else has been swapped out. It layers under a shirt, over a knit, and beside chains you already own.

Beaded strands and long ropes

Freshwater pearls are the most affordable way to own a full strand. A long rope can be worn straight, doubled at the collarbone, or knotted once and left, giving three necklaces from one piece.

Layered and floating styles

Layered pieces give you two or three lengths already balanced on one clasp. Floating strands space pearls along a fine chain so they appear to sit directly on the skin. Both make an outfit look considered without asking you to work out proportions.

What colors do freshwater pearls come in?

White, cream, pink, peach and lavender all occur without treatment in freshwater pearls, which is a range no other cultured pearl matches. Freshwater pearls also take dye well, and that is precisely why treatment disclosure matters. We state treatment on every product page as one of eight provenance markers, rather than leaving it unsaid.

Frequently asked questions

Are freshwater pearls worth buying?

Yes. They are real cultured pearls with thick nacre, available in more shapes and colors than any other type, at a price that lets you own more than one. If you want the classic round white strand, Akoya is the closer match. For everything else, freshwater gives you more.

How can you tell a freshwater pearl from an Akoya?

Akoya pearls are consistently round with a sharp mirror-like reflection. Freshwater pearls are rarely perfectly round and their luster is softer and deeper, because the pearl is solid nacre rather than a thin layer over a bead.

Do freshwater pearls last?

They last longer than most bead-nucleated pearls, because solid nacre cannot wear through to a shell core. Keep them away from perfume, hairspray and cleaning products, wipe them with a soft damp cloth, and store them where air circulates.

What length freshwater pearl necklace should I buy?

Sixteen to eighteen inches is the most adaptable. It falls at or just below the collarbone and works with a crew neck, an open collar and a blazer without adjustment. Choose longer only if you know which necklines you will pair it with.

Are dyed freshwater pearls still real pearls?

Yes, dyeing changes color but not authenticity. What matters is that the treatment is disclosed. A dyed pearl sold as naturally colored is a misrepresentation, which is why treatment appears on every one of our product pages.
